I won the SF19 single player event with -15 ahead minimum

Controller Sensitivity: 7
TC: 0
ABS: OFF

Brake Balance: 0
Ride: 1.73 - 3,54
NF: 6.00 - 5.90
AB: 4 - 6
Compression: 53 - 52
Rebound: 84 - 83
Camber: 2.2 - 1.7
Toe: Out 0.25 - In 0.50
DF: 1600 - 2100
LSD: 5 - 5 - 5
Top Speed: 217 (MPH)
Final Gear: 4.164
2.200 - 81
1.675 - 107
1.337 - 134
1.124 - 160
0.949 - 189
0.841 - 228

I only use 5 gears, 6th is just for extra speed in slipstream

Max Speed: 7.7
Acceleration: 8.7
Braking: 8.5
Cornering: 8.7
Stability: 8.0
